Abstract

<P>PROBLEM TO BE SOLVED: To provide a container with which constant medical efficacy of a gelatinous substance can be obtained for a period of use. <P>SOLUTION: The container 1 equipped with a storage chamber 24 for the gelatinous substance 25 inside and an aperture 20 passing through inside and outside the storage chamber 24 on at least one portion of a side face has a protrusion 9 provided on at least the bottom of the storage chamber 24. When the gelatinous substance 25 is filled in the storage chamber 24, the protrusion 9 on the side of the container 1 is buried into the center of the substance 25, and the substance 25 is gradually reduced in volume to be solidified while being supported by the protrusion 9. Therefore, the gelatinous substance 25 is prevented from moving to a corner of the container 1 at the end of its period of use, so that constant medical efficacy of the substance 25 can be obtained over the whole period of use. <P>COPYRIGHT: (C)2004,JPO&NCIPI

Description

【0001】
【発明の属する技術分野】
本発明は、容器及びインジケーターに関し、特に、内部にゲル状物が充填される容器及びそのゲル状物の状態を経時的に表示させるインジケーターに関するものである。
【0002】
【従来の技術】
従来、内部にゲル状物の収納室が設けられるとともに、表面側に収納室内外を貫通する開口部が設けられ、この開口部を介して収納室内外間で空気を流通させることにより、居間、寝室、トイレ等の室内空間や車の車内空間、洋服ダンス、押入、下駄箱、冷蔵庫等の収納空間(以下「空間」という。)の内部の脱臭、防虫等を行うように構成した容器が知られている。また、側面に開口部を設け、該開口部を介して揮散させることにより、効率良く空間に薬効を付与できるように構成した容器が提案されている(例えば、特許文献1参照。)。
【0003】
【特許文献1】
特開平2−82980号公報
【0004】
【発明が解決しようとする課題】
ところで、上記のような構成の容器にあっては、収納室内に充填されているゲル状物は、脱臭、防虫等が進行することにより体積を徐々に減少させて固化する特性を有しているため、使用の初期においては特に問題はないが、終期においてはゲル状物が収納室内の隅等にずれてしまう。そのため、開口部を介してゲル状物に十分に空気を流通させることができなくなり、ゲル状物の薬効が未だ残っている状態で使用ができなくなってしまうという問題点を有していた。また、使用者は、開口部を介して内部のゲル状物の残存状態を正確に確認しにくくなり、ゲル状物の薬効が残っているにも関わらず廃棄してしまったり、ゲル状物の薬効が消失した状態で使用を続けてしまうといった問題も生じていた。
【0005】
本発明は、上記のような従来のもののもつ問題を解決したものであって、使用の終期においても、ゲル状物の薬効が十分に得られるとともに、ゲル状物の残存状態を経時的に正確に把握することができて、ゲル状物の薬効が残っているのに廃棄してしまったり、ゲル状物の薬効が消失したままで使用を続けるようなことがない、容器及びインジケーターを提供することを目的とするものである。
【0006】
【課題を解決するための手段】
上記のような課題を解決するために、本発明の請求項1に係る容器は、内部にゲル状物の収納室が設けられるとともに、側面の少なくとも一箇所に前記収納室内外を貫通する開口部が設けられる容器において、前記収納室の少なくとも底面側に上方に突出する突起物を一体に設け、該突起物を前記収納室内に充填されるゲル状物内に埋没させた手段を採用している。
また、本発明の請求項2に係る容器は、請求項1に記載の容器において、前記収納室の上面側にも前記突起物を設けた手段を採用している。
さらに、本発明の請求項3に係る容器は、請求項2に記載の容器において、前記下面側の突起物と前記上面側の突起物とは、所定の間隔をおいて形成されている手段を採用している。
さらに、本発明の請求項4に係る容器は、請求項1から3の何れかに記載の容器において、前記開口部は、前記容器の全長及び全幅に渡って所定の間隔ごとに複数箇所に設けられている手段を採用している。
さらに、本発明の請求項5に係る容器は、請求項1から4の何れかに記載の容器において、前記突起物は、板状又は柱状である手段を採用している。
さらに、本発明の請求項6に係るインジケーターは、請求項1から5の何れかに記載の容器を使用し、前記収納室内に充填されたゲル状物の状態を前記開口部を介して経時的に表示させるように構成した手段を採用している。
【0007】
【作用】
本発明は、上記のような手段を採用したことにより、収納室内にゲル状物を充填すると、そのゲル状物内に収納室の底面側の突起物又は底面側の突起物と上面側の突起物が埋没した状態で位置することになる。そして、この状態で開口部を介して収納室内外間を流通する空気がゲル状物に接触することにより脱臭、防虫等が行われ、ゲル状物は徐々に体積を減少させて固化することになる。この場合、ゲル状物内には突起物が埋設されているので、ゲル状物は突起物に保持された状態で体積を減少させて固化することになる。
【0008】
【発明の実施の形態】
以下、図面に示す本発明の実施の形態について説明する。
図1〜図8には、本発明による容器の一実施の形態が示されていて、この容器1は、前面側が開口する角箱状の容器本体2と、容器本体2の前面側開口部を閉塞する後面側が開口する角箱状の蓋14とを備えている。
【0009】
容器本体2は、図3〜図5に示すように、上板3、下板4、後板5、及び2枚の側板6、7からなるものであって、開口周縁部には全周に渡って所定の深さの係合溝13が設けられ、この係合溝13内に後述する蓋14の係合突起21が係合されるようになっている。容器本体2の後板5と側板6、7との間の境界部は所定の曲率のアール面に形成され、このアール面により容器本体2内の空間12の角部が所定の曲率のアール面に形成され、このアール面により容器本体2内に充填されるゲル状物を滑らかに体積減少させるようになっている。
【0010】
容器本体2の内面側の下板4の中央部には、垂直方向上方に突出する突起物9が一体に設けられている。突起物9は、略L形板状をなすものであって、下板4から後板5の下端部にかけて一体に設けられている。下板4と後板5との境界部に位置する突起物9の根元の部分には、突起物9を両側から挟持するように支持部11が一体に設けられている。
【0011】
容器本体2の内面側の上板3の中央部には、垂直方向下方に突出する突起物8が一体に設けられている。突起物8は、下板4側の突起物9と同様に略L形板状をなすものであって、上板3から後板5の上端部にかけて一体に設けられている。上板3と後板5との境界部に位置する突起物8の根元の部分には、下板4側の突起物9と同様に、突起物8を両側から挟持するように支持部10が一体に設けられている。そして、下板4側の突起物9の上端と、上板3側の突起物8の下端は互いに接触しておらず、所定の間隔をあけて離れて形成されている。
【0012】
下板4の突起物9及び上板3の突起物8は、L形板状に限らず、三角板状、四角板状、円柱状、角柱状等としても良いし、その他の任意の形状としても良い。要は、後述するゲル状物の中心部に埋設可能な形状であれば良い。
【0013】
蓋14は、図6〜図8に示すように、上板15、下板16、前板17、及び2枚の側板18、19からなる後面側が開口する角箱状をなすものであって、内面側に容器本体2の開口部の外面側を嵌合させることで、容器本体2の開口部に装着されるようになっている。
【0014】
この場合、蓋14の内面側の上板15の中央部、下板16の中央部、及び両側板18、19の両端部には、それぞれ内方に突出する係合突起21が一体に設けられ、これらの係合突起21は容器本体2の開口縁部の係合溝13内に係合されるようになっている。
【0015】
蓋14の上板15には、内外を貫通する四角形状の開口部20が全長及び全幅に渡って、所定の間隔ごとに複数箇所に設けられるようになっている。開口部20は、四角形状に限らず、三角形状、六角形状等としても良い。
【0016】
蓋14の上板15の内面側の中央部及び下板16の内面側の中央部には、それぞれ内方に突出する突起22、23が一体に設けられ、この突起22、23は蓋14を容器本体2の開口部に装着した際に、容器本体2側の各突起物8、9の先端に当接するようになっている。
【0017】
そして、上記のように構成した容器本体2の開口部に蓋14を装着し、蓋14側の係合突起21を容器本体2側の係合溝13内に係合させることで、この実施の形態による容器1が構成され、内部に略直方体状の空間である収納室24が形成されることになる。
【0018】
そして、上記のような構成の容器1の収納室24内に、図1に示すように、例えば、液体の防虫剤、芳香剤、脱臭剤とゲル化剤を混合したものを充填して冷却固化させたゲル状物25を形成し、この状態で容器1を収納空間に設置すると、収納空間内部の空気が開口部20を介して収納室24内外間を流通してゲル状物25に接触し、収納空間が脱臭されおよび/または、防虫剤や芳香剤が揮散して収納空間に防虫効果や芳香が付与されることになる。
【0019】
そして、脱臭、防虫、芳香等が進行すると、ゲル状物25は、体積を徐々に減少させて固化していくことになるが、ゲル状物25の上面中央部及び下面中央部には容器1側の突起物8、9がそれぞれ埋設された状態となっているので、ゲル状物25は、使用の初期においては両突起物8、9に保持された状態で体積を減少させ、終期においては、図2に示すように、ゲルの収縮およびゲルの自重により上板3側の突起物8の保持が外れ、下側の突起物9のみに保持された状態で体積を減少させていくことになる。
【0020】
従って、全使用期間において、ゲル状物25は必ず容器1の中央部に突起物9に保持された状態で位置することになるので、使用の終期において、ゲル状物25が容器1の隅部にずれてしまってゲル状物25による薬効が得られなくなるようなことはなく、全使用期間において、ゲル状物25による一定の薬効が得られることになる。
【0021】
また、上記の容器1は、開口部20を介して収納室24内に充填したゲル状物25の体積の変化を経時的に目視することにより、ゲル状物25の状態を経時的に把握できるインジケーターとしても機能することになるので、ゲル状物25の薬効が残っているにもかかわらず廃棄してしまったり、薬効が得られなくなった状態で使用を続けてしまうようなことはないものである。
【0022】
なお、前記の説明においては、容器1の上板3と下板4の両方に突起物8、9を設けたが、ゲル状物25の種類によっては、上板3の突起物8を省略して下板4のみに突起物9を設けても良いものである。また、前記の説明においては、容器1を略角箱状に形成したが、これに限定することなく、他の周知の形状としても良いものである。
【0023】
【発明の効果】
本発明は、前記のように構成したことにより、収納室内に充填されるゲル状物は、突起物が埋設された状態で徐々に体積を減少させていくことになる。従って、例えば、突起物を容器の底面の中央部、又は底面及び上面の中央部に設けることにより、使用の終期においても、ゲル状物を容器の中央部に位置させることができるので、使用の周期においても初期と同様のゲル状物による薬効が得られることになり、全使用期間を通じてゲル状物による一定の薬効が得られることになる。
さらに、容器は、開口部を介して収納室内のゲル状物の状態を経時的に目視することにより、ゲル状物の状態を経時的に把握できるインジケーターとしても機能することになるので、ゲル状物の薬効が残っているにもかかわらず廃棄してしまったり、薬効が得られない状態で使用を続けるようなことはなくなるものである。

[0001]
TECHNICAL FIELD OF THE INVENTION
The present invention relates to a container and an indicator, and more particularly to a container in which a gel-like substance is filled and an indicator for displaying the state of the gel-like substance with time.
[0002]
[Prior art]
Conventionally, a storage room for a gel-like material is provided inside, and an opening penetrating the storage room is provided on the surface side, and air is circulated between the storage room and the outside through this opening, so that a living room, a bedroom is provided. 2. Description of the Related Art Containers configured to perform deodorization, insect control, and the like inside a storage space (hereinafter, referred to as a "space") such as an indoor space such as a toilet, a vehicle interior space, a clothes dance, a closet, a clog box, and a refrigerator are known. ing. In addition, a container has been proposed in which an opening is provided on the side surface, and the container is configured to volatilize through the opening to efficiently impart a medicinal effect to a space (for example, see Patent Document 1).
[0003]
[Patent Document 1]
JP-A-2-82980
[Problems to be solved by the invention]
By the way, in the container having the above-described configuration, the gel-like material filled in the storage chamber has a property of gradually decreasing its volume and solidifying as deodorization and insect control progress. Therefore, there is no particular problem in the early stage of use, but in the final stage, the gel-like material is shifted to a corner or the like in the storage room. For this reason, there has been a problem that air cannot be sufficiently circulated through the opening through the gel-like material, and the gel-like material cannot be used while its medicinal effect still remains. In addition, it becomes difficult for the user to accurately check the remaining state of the gel-like substance inside through the opening, and even though the medicinal properties of the gel-like substance remain, the user may discard the gel-like substance or remove the gel-like substance. There has also been a problem that the use is continued in a state where the medicinal effect has disappeared.
[0005]
The present invention has solved the above-mentioned problems of the prior art.Even at the end of use, the medicinal properties of the gel can be sufficiently obtained and the residual state of the gel can be accurately determined with time. Provide a container and an indicator that can be grasped at a time and are not discarded even though the medicinal properties of the gel remain, and do not continue to be used with the medicinal properties of the gel disappeared. It is intended for that purpose.
[0006]
[Means for Solving the Problems]
In order to solve the above-mentioned problem, the container according to claim 1 of the present invention is provided with a gel-like material storage chamber inside, and an opening penetrating through the storage chamber outside at least one location on a side surface. In the container provided with, a means is provided in which at least a protrusion protruding upward is integrally provided at least on the bottom surface side of the storage chamber, and the protrusion is buried in a gel-like substance filled in the storage chamber. .
The container according to a second aspect of the present invention employs the container according to the first aspect, wherein the protrusion is provided also on the upper surface side of the storage chamber.
Further, the container according to claim 3 of the present invention is the container according to claim 2, wherein the protrusion on the lower surface side and the protrusion on the upper surface side are formed at a predetermined interval. Has adopted.
Furthermore, the container according to claim 4 of the present invention is the container according to any one of claims 1 to 3, wherein the openings are provided at a plurality of locations at predetermined intervals over the entire length and the entire width of the container. Measures that have been adopted.
Further, the container according to claim 5 of the present invention employs the container according to any one of claims 1 to 4, wherein the protrusion has a plate or column shape.
Further, the indicator according to claim 6 of the present invention uses the container according to any one of claims 1 to 5, and changes the state of the gel-like substance filled in the storage chamber over time through the opening. Is adopted.
[0007]
[Action]
According to the present invention, by employing the above-described means, when the storage chamber is filled with a gel-like substance, the bottom-side projection or the bottom-side projection and the top-side projection of the storage chamber are filled in the gel-like substance. The object will be located in a buried state. Then, in this state, air flowing between the outside and inside of the storage chamber comes into contact with the gel-like material through the opening to perform deodorization and insect control, and the gel-like material gradually decreases in volume and solidifies. . In this case, since the projections are embedded in the gel, the gel is reduced in volume and solidified while being held by the projections.
[0008]
BEST MODE FOR CARRYING OUT THE INVENTION
Hereinafter, embodiments of the present invention shown in the drawings will be described.
1 to 8 show an embodiment of a container according to the present invention. The container 1 has a rectangular box-shaped container body 2 having an open front side, and a front side opening of the container body 2. And a rectangular box-shaped lid 14 having an open rear side.
[0009]
As shown in FIGS. 3 to 5, the container body 2 includes an upper plate 3, a lower plate 4, a rear plate 5, and two side plates 6 and 7. An engaging groove 13 having a predetermined depth is provided across the engaging groove 13, and an engaging protrusion 21 of a lid 14 described later is engaged in the engaging groove 13. The boundary between the rear plate 5 and the side plates 6 and 7 of the container body 2 is formed on a curved surface with a predetermined curvature, and the corner of the space 12 in the container body 2 is formed with a curved surface with the predetermined curvature. , And the volume of the gel-like substance filled in the container body 2 is smoothly reduced by the round surface.
[0010]
At the center of the lower plate 4 on the inner surface side of the container body 2, a projection 9 projecting vertically upward is integrally provided. The protrusion 9 has a substantially L-shaped plate shape, and is integrally provided from the lower plate 4 to the lower end of the rear plate 5. A support portion 11 is integrally provided at the base of the projection 9 located at the boundary between the lower plate 4 and the rear plate 5 so as to sandwich the projection 9 from both sides.
[0011]
At the center of the upper plate 3 on the inner surface side of the container body 2, a projection 8 projecting downward in the vertical direction is integrally provided. The protrusion 8 has a substantially L-shaped plate shape like the protrusion 9 on the lower plate 4 side, and is provided integrally from the upper plate 3 to the upper end of the rear plate 5. At the base of the protrusion 8 located at the boundary between the upper plate 3 and the rear plate 5, similarly to the protrusion 9 on the lower plate 4 side, a supporting portion 10 is provided so as to sandwich the protrusion 8 from both sides. It is provided integrally. The upper end of the protrusion 9 on the lower plate 4 side and the lower end of the protrusion 8 on the upper plate 3 are not in contact with each other, and are formed apart from each other at a predetermined interval.
[0012]
The projections 9 of the lower plate 4 and the projections 8 of the upper plate 3 are not limited to L-shaped plates, but may be triangular plates, square plates, columns, prisms, or any other shapes. good. In short, any shape may be used as long as it can be embedded in the center of the gel-like material described later.
[0013]
As shown in FIGS. 6 to 8, the lid 14 has a square box shape with an open rear surface including an upper plate 15, a lower plate 16, a front plate 17, and two side plates 18 and 19. The outer surface side of the opening of the container body 2 is fitted to the inner surface side, so that the container body 2 is attached to the opening of the container body 2.
[0014]
In this case, engaging projections 21 protruding inward are provided integrally at the central portion of the upper plate 15, the central portion of the lower plate 16, and both end portions of the side plates 18 and 19 on the inner surface side of the lid 14. The engagement projections 21 are adapted to be engaged in the engagement grooves 13 at the opening edge of the container body 2.
[0015]
The upper plate 15 of the lid 14 is provided with a plurality of rectangular openings 20 penetrating the inside and outside at predetermined intervals over the entire length and the entire width. The opening 20 is not limited to a square shape, but may be a triangular shape, a hexagonal shape, or the like.
[0016]
Inwardly protruding projections 22 and 23 are integrally provided at a central portion on the inner surface side of the upper plate 15 of the lid 14 and a central portion on the inner surface side of the lower plate 16, respectively. When attached to the opening of the container body 2, it comes into contact with the tips of the projections 8 and 9 on the container body 2 side.
[0017]
Then, the lid 14 is attached to the opening of the container main body 2 configured as described above, and the engaging projection 21 on the lid 14 is engaged with the engaging groove 13 on the container main body 2 side. The container 1 according to the embodiment is configured, and a storage chamber 24 that is a substantially rectangular parallelepiped space is formed therein.
[0018]
Then, as shown in FIG. 1, for example, a mixture of a liquid insect repellent, a fragrance, a deodorant and a gelling agent is filled into the storage chamber 24 of the container 1 having the above-described configuration, and the mixture is cooled and solidified. When the container 1 is placed in the storage space in this state, the air in the storage space flows between the inside and the outside of the storage chamber 24 through the opening 20 and comes into contact with the gel 25. In addition, the storage space is deodorized and / or the insect repellent or the fragrance is volatilized, so that the storage space is provided with an insect repellent effect or fragrance.
[0019]
Then, as deodorization, insect repellent, aroma and the like progress, the gel-like material 25 gradually decreases in volume and solidifies, but the container 1 is located at the center of the upper surface and the center of the lower surface of the gel-like material 25. Since the protrusions 8 and 9 on the side are respectively buried, the gel 25 is reduced in volume while being held by the protrusions 8 and 9 in the early stage of use, and at the end of use. As shown in FIG. 2, the holding of the projection 8 on the upper plate 3 side is released due to the contraction of the gel and the weight of the gel, and the volume is reduced while being held only by the lower projection 9. Become.
[0020]
Therefore, during the entire use period, the gel-like material 25 is always located at the center of the container 1 while being held by the projection 9, so that at the end of use, the gel-like material 25 is placed at the corner of the container 1. There is no possibility that the medicinal effect of the gel-like material 25 cannot be obtained due to the deviation, and a certain medicinal effect of the gel-like material 25 can be obtained during the entire use period.
[0021]
In the container 1, the state of the gel 25 can be grasped over time by visually observing the change in volume of the gel 25 filled in the storage chamber 24 through the opening 20 over time. Since it will also function as an indicator, it will not be discarded despite the medicinal properties of the gel 25 remaining, or will not continue to be used in a state where no medicinal properties are obtained. is there.
[0022]
In the above description, the projections 8 and 9 are provided on both the upper plate 3 and the lower plate 4 of the container 1. However, depending on the type of the gel 25, the projections 8 of the upper plate 3 are omitted. The protrusion 9 may be provided only on the lower plate 4. Further, in the above description, the container 1 is formed in a substantially rectangular box shape, but the present invention is not limited to this, and may have another known shape.
[0023]
【The invention's effect】
According to the present invention configured as described above, the volume of the gel-like material filled in the storage chamber is gradually reduced in a state in which the protrusions are embedded. Therefore, for example, by providing the protrusion at the center of the bottom surface of the container or at the center of the bottom surface and the upper surface, the gel-like material can be located at the center of the container even at the end of use. In the cycle, the same drug effect as in the initial stage can be obtained, and a certain drug effect can be obtained through the entire use period.
Further, the container can also function as an indicator that can grasp the state of the gel-like substance over time by visually observing the state of the gel-like substance in the storage chamber through the opening, so that the gel-like state can be obtained. It is no longer possible to discard a product despite its remaining medicinal properties or to continue using it without obtaining any medicinal properties.
